System Requirements

Before you begin the installation, make sure your system meets the following requirements:

For Windows:

- OS: Windows 10 (64-bit) or later - RAM: 4 GB (8 GB recommended) - GPU: DirectX 10 compatible graphics card - Storage: 500 MB free disk space for the application

For macOS:

- OS: macOS 10.9 or later - RAM: 4 GB (8 GB recommended) - Storage: 500 MB free disk space for the application

Installation Steps

Step 1: Download the Software

1. Go to the [Affinity website](https://affinity.serif.com/). 2. Navigate to the product you want to install (Affinity Designer, Photo, or Publisher). 3. Select the version appropriate for your operating system (Windows or macOS). 4. Click on the download button and save the installer file to your computer.

Step 2: Run the Installer

For Windows:

1. Locate the downloaded .exe file and double-click it. 2. Follow the on-screen instructions to install the software. You may need to grant permission for the installer to make changes.

For macOS:

1. Locate the downloaded .dmg file and double-click it to mount the disk image. 2. Drag and drop the application icon into your Applications folder to install it. 3. Eject the disk image once the installation is complete.

Step 3: Launch the Application

- Windows: Find the application in the Start menu or search for it using the search bar. - macOS: Open your Applications folder and double-click the application icon.

Step 4: Initial Setup

Upon launching the application for the first time, you may be prompted to: - Accept the license agreement - Set up preferences (e.g., UI appearance, toolbars) - Import previous preferences if upgrading from a previous version
